The observed concentrations of magnesium (Mg²⁺), sodium (Na⁺), and bicarbonate (HCO₃) in saturated extract of a soil sample taken from the root zone are 5.68 meq L⁻¹, 9.90 meq L⁻¹, and 11.20 meq L⁻¹, respectively. If the concentration ratio of HCO₃/Ca²⁺ is 2.8, the sodium adsorption ratio is [round off to 2 decimal places]
Correct : 4.50
